Define Your Requirements: Before embarking on your quest to find the perfect casting manufacturer, it's imperative to clearly define your requirements. Consider factors such as the type of casting method (e.g., sand casting, investment casting, die casting), material specifications, production volume, quality standards, and budget constraints. By establishing these parameters upfront, you'll streamline the selection process and narrow down your options to manufacturers capable of meeting your exact needs.
Assess Manufacturing Capabilities: Evaluate the manufacturing capabilities of potential casting suppliers. Look for manufacturers equipped with state-of-the-art facilities, advanced technologies, and a skilled workforce. Assess their expertise in your specific industry or niche, as well as their track record of delivering high-quality castings within stipulated timelines. A thorough assessment of manufacturing capabilities ensures that your chosen manufacturer possesses the expertise and resources to fulfill your requirements with precision and consistency.
Quality Assurance Measures: Quality assurance is non-negotiable when it comes to casting manufacturing. Scrutinize the quality control processes and certifications implemented by prospective manufacturers to ensure compliance with industry standards and regulatory requirements. Inquire about inspection protocols, material testing procedures, and documentation practices to ascertain the manufacturer's commitment to producing defect-free castings of superior quality. Prioritize manufacturers with robust quality assurance measures in place to safeguard the integrity and reliability of your products.
Consider Supply Chain Dynamics: A reliable and efficient supply chain is instrumental in maintaining seamless production workflows and minimizing lead times. Evaluate the supply chain dynamics of casting manufacturers, including raw material sourcing, inventory management, and logistics capabilities. Opt for manufacturers with a well-established supply chain network and strategic partnerships to mitigate risks associated with material shortages, production delays, and unforeseen disruptions. A resilient supply chain enhances the agility and responsiveness of your manufacturing operations, fostering greater competitiveness in the market.
